About St. Martin County, Louisiana

St. Martin Parish divides its geography between two distinct landscapes, split by the massive, shifting presence of the Atchafalaya Basin. To the west, the land stretches across flat, alluvial plains where the soil holds a heavy, dark dampness, well-suited for the tall stalks of sugarcane that catch the light like polished emeralds in midsummer. To the east, the terrain yields to the intricate, flooded labyrinth of the swamp, a world of deep-water cypress knees and slow-moving bayous that darken to the color of strong tea. The air here remains heavy with a persistent, humid weight, and at dusk, the horizon dissolves into a hazy, bruised purple where the sky meets the water, blurring the distinction between the firm ground and the river-fed marshes.

St. Martin Parish traces its origins to the arrival of Acadian refugees who sought refuge in the fertile prairie and along the winding waterways after their expulsion from the north. These settlers established a distinct social order, relying on the land’s bounty and the river’s reach to sustain their families. The parish seat grew into a center of commerce and administration, anchored by its proximity to the navigable waters that served as the primary arteries for trade and communication. Life in those early decades moved in accord with the seasonal cycles of the river and the harvest, creating a society that valued the resilience of the household and the preservation of a singular, distinct vernacular that still colors the way people speak to one another across the garden fence.
